How To Calculate Profit Margins On A Home Sale

can you sell a house you just bought

When selling your house after buying, understanding how to calculate your profit margins is an important part of the process. To help you accurately determine the amount of money you will make on the sale, consider these key factors: start by determining what you paid for the home originally and add in any improvements that have been made since then.

Next, take into account closing costs and other fees associated with selling a house such as inspection costs, real estate agent commission, and legal fees. Finally, review recent sales data in your area to set a price that is competitive yet still allows for a decent profit margin.

Knowing how to accurately calculate your profits from selling a home can help ensure you get the most out of the sale.

Common Reasons For Selling A House After Just Purchasing It

how soon can you move after buying a house

Selling your house after buying it can be a difficult and emotionally draining process. There are several common reasons why people make the decision to sell their home shortly after purchasing it.

These include the need for more space, relocation for work or personal reasons, financial hardship, and unforeseen changes in lifestyle. In some cases, buyers may realize that the home they purchased is no longer suitable for their needs.

For instance, if they find out they are expecting a baby or getting married soon after buying their home, they may need to upgrade to something larger. Other times, people need to move away due to job opportunities or family obligations; this often requires them to put their newly acquired property up for sale.

Finally, unanticipated financial problems may arise that make it necessary to sell in order to alleviate burdensome debt and financial stress. Selling a house shortly after buying it can be tricky but by understanding the most common reasons and being prepared ahead of time, you can navigate the process with greater ease.

Investigating Potential Financial Implications Of Selling A Home Early

how soon can i sell my house

When selling a home, it is important to consider the financial implications of doing so before making any decisions. There may be taxes owed on profits from the sale and closing costs that must be paid at the time of sale.

Homeowners should look into whether their area has capital gains tax laws, which may require paying taxes on profits from a sale if the residence was owned for less than two years. Furthermore, mortgage lenders may charge a prepayment penalty if the loan is paid off early.

Homeowners should check their contract to see if this applies and calculate how much they would need to pay in order to properly budget for the sale. Finally, it is important to consider whether or not there are any associated costs with listing the property on the market such as realtor fees or advertising expenses.

Knowing what these potential costs are prior to putting your home up for sale can help you plan accordingly and make an informed decision regarding when and how to sell your home.
